Metropolitan vs. Cosmopolitan: Know the Difference

Shumaila Saeed
By Shumaila Saeed || Updated on December 25, 2023
Metropolitan refers to a large, densely populated urban area, often a central city with its suburbs, while cosmopolitan describes a place or culture characterized by a diverse mix of people, cultures, and ideas.
Metropolitan vs. Cosmopolitan

Key Differences

Metropolitan areas are defined by their urban concentration and the integration of the central city with its surrounding suburbs. Cosmopolitan places, on the other hand, are known for their diversity and the inclusion of various cultures, ethnicities, and viewpoints.

The term 'metropolitan' often implies a focus on the structural and demographic aspects of a city, including its size and economic activities. 'Cosmopolitan' emphasizes cultural diversity and open-mindedness, often associated with a variety of international influences.

Metropolitan areas are typically hubs of economic, political, and social activity, reflecting the central role of cities in a region. Cosmopolitan locales are seen as melting pots of global cultures, often attracting people from around the world with their inclusive and worldly atmosphere.

In a metropolitan context, there is an emphasis on urban planning, infrastructure, and governance that supports a large population. Cosmopolitan environments are celebrated for their cultural richness, including diverse cuisines, arts, and lifestyle options.

Metropolitan areas can exist without being cosmopolitan, as they may lack cultural diversity. Conversely, a place can be cosmopolitan without being a large metropolitan area, as it may embody diversity and openness in a smaller or more rural setting.
